linux7防火墙命令手册
-
Linux 7防火墙命令手册
防火墙在保障计算机网络安全方面起着至关重要的作用。Linux 7 提供了一套强大的、灵活的防火墙工具,可以帮助我们进行网络安全的配置与管理。本文将为大家介绍一些常用的Linux 7防火墙命令。
1. 查看防火墙状态
要查看当前防火墙的状态,可以使用如下命令:
“`
firewall-cmd –state
“`该命令将显示防火墙是否处于活动状态。
2. 开启/关闭防火墙
若要开启防火墙,可以使用以下命令:
“`
systemctl start firewalld
“`要关闭防火墙,可以使用以下命令:
“`
systemctl stop firewalld
“`3. 重启防火墙
若要重启防火墙,可以使用以下命令:
“`
systemctl restart firewalld
“`4. 永久开启/关闭防火墙
若要设置防火墙开机自动启动,可以使用以下命令:
“`
systemctl enable firewalld
“`要取消防火墙开机自动启动,可以使用以下命令:
“`
systemctl disable firewalld
“`5. 添加端口
若要允许某个特定的端口通过防火墙,可以使用以下命令:
“`
firewall-cmd –zone=public –add-port=端口/协议
“`例如,要添加HTTP协议的80端口,可以使用以下命令:
“`
firewall-cmd –zone=public –add-port=80/tcp
“`6. 移除端口
若要移除已添加的端口,可以使用以下命令:
“`
firewall-cmd –zone=public –remove-port=端口/协议
“`7. 查看已开放的端口
要查看已开放的端口列表,可以使用以下命令:
“`
firewall-cmd –zone=public –list-ports
“`8. 添加服务
若要允许某个特定的服务通过防火墙,可以使用以下命令:
“`
firewall-cmd –zone=public –add-service=服务名称
“`例如,要添加SSH服务,可以使用以下命令:
“`
firewall-cmd –zone=public –add-service=ssh
“`9. 移除服务
若要移除已添加的服务,可以使用以下命令:
“`
firewall-cmd –zone=public –remove-service=服务名称
“`10. 查看已开放的服务
要查看已开放的服务列表,可以使用以下命令:
“`
firewall-cmd –zone=public –list-services
“`总结:
本文介绍了一些常用的Linux 7防火墙命令,包括查看防火墙状态、开启/关闭防火墙、重启防火墙、永久开启/关闭防火墙、添加端口、移除端口、查看已开放的端口、添加服务、移除服务和查看已开放的服务等。通过熟练掌握这些命令,我们可以更好地配置和管理Linux 7防火墙,保障计算机网络的安全性。
2年前 -
Linux 7防火墙命令手册
Linux系统中有多种方法来管理防火墙,其中包括使用图形界面工具和使用命令行。在Linux 7中,有一些特定的命令可以用来配置和管理防火墙。以下是Linux 7防火墙命令手册:
1. systemctl命令:systemctl命令是Linux系统中管理系统服务的主要命令之一。在Linux 7中,防火墙服务是通过Firewalld服务管理的。可以使用systemctl命令来启动、停止和重新加载Firewalld服务。例如,要启动Firewalld服务,可以使用以下命令:`systemctl start firewalld`。
2. firewall-cmd命令:firewall-cmd命令是Firewalld服务的主要管理工具。可以使用firewall-cmd命令来配置防火墙规则、添加和删除防火墙端口以及查询防火墙状态。例如,要添加一个将TCP端口8080打开的规则,可以使用以下命令:`firewall-cmd –zone=public –add-port=8080/tcp –permanent`。
3. firewalld命令:firewalld命令是一个与firewall-cmd命令相似的命令,用于配置防火墙规则。但是,不同于firewall-cmd命令,firewalld命令需要先启动firewalld服务,然后才能使用。例如,要启动firewalld服务,可以使用以下命令:`systemctl start firewalld`,然后可以使用firewalld命令来配置防火墙规则。
4. iptables命令:iptables命令是Linux系统中一个用于配置和管理防火墙规则的传统命令。在Linux 7中,firewalld服务代替了以前的iptables服务,但是iptables命令仍然可以使用。可以使用iptables命令来添加、删除和查询防火墙规则。例如,要添加一个将TCP端口8080打开的规则,可以使用以下命令:`iptables -A INPUT -p tcp –dport 8080 -j ACCEPT`。
5. getenforce命令:getenforce命令用于查询系统的SELinux(安全增强Linux)状态。SELinux是一种Linux内核安全模块,用于实施强制访问控制(MAC)机制。在Linux 7中,默认情况下,SELinux处于强制模式。可以使用getenforce命令来查询当前的SELinux状态。例如,要查询当前SELinux的状态,可以使用以下命令:`getenforce`。
以上是Linux 7中常用的防火墙命令手册。使用这些命令可以帮助管理员配置和管理防火墙规则,确保系统的安全性。
2年前 -
Linux 7防火墙命令手册
引言:
防火墙是一种用于保护计算机网络安全的系统。它可以根据预先设定的规则过滤网络中进出的数据包。在Linux系统中,可以使用防火墙来限制网络访问和保护系统免受恶意攻击。
本文将介绍Linux 7系统中常用的防火墙命令及其操作流程。一、安装Firewalld
Firewalld是Linux 7系统中默认的防火墙工具。如果系统尚未安装Firewalld,可以使用以下命令安装:
“`
sudo yum install firewalld
“`二、基本概念
在使用防火墙命令之前,首先需要了解一些基本概念:
1. 防火墙区域(Zone):在Firewalld中,每一个网络接口或网络区域都属于一个特定的防火墙区域。例如,public、internal、dmz等。
2. 防火墙规则(Rule):防火墙规则定义了数据包在进出网络接口时的处理方式。可以使用防火墙规则来允许或者禁止特定的网络流量。
3. 服务(Service):服务指特定的网络服务,如SSH、HTTP等。Firewalld预定义了一些常见的服务。
三、常用命令
以下是Linux 7中常用的防火墙命令:
1. 启动防火墙
“`
sudo systemctl start firewalld
“`2. 停止防火墙
“`
sudo systemctl stop firewalld
“`3. 查看防火墙状态
“`
sudo systemctl status firewalld
“`4. 设为开机启动
“`
sudo systemctl enable firewalld
“`5. 添加规则
可以使用以下命令向防火墙添加规则:
“`
sudo firewall-cmd –zone=public –add-port=80/tcp –permanent
“`上述命令将在public区域开放80端口的TCP流量。
注意:–permanent选项表示新增的规则将在系统重启后仍然有效。
6. 移除规则
可以使用以下命令从防火墙中移除规则:
“`
sudo firewall-cmd –zone=public –remove-port=80/tcp –permanent
“`上述命令将从public区域移除80端口的TCP规则。
7. 列出规则
可以使用以下命令列出当前防火墙的规则:
“`
sudo firewall-cmd –zone=public –list-all
“`该命令将列出public区域的所有规则。
8. 重新加载防火墙
可以使用以下命令重新加载防火墙配置:
“`
sudo firewall-cmd –reload
“`
该命令将重新加载防火墙配置文件,并应用新的规则。四、常用操作流程
在实际使用防火墙时,常用的操作流程如下:
1. 启动防火墙:使用`systemctl start firewalld`命令启动防火墙。
2. 确定防火墙区域:使用`firewall-cmd –get-default-zone`命令确定当前的默认区域。
默认区域一般为”public”,也可以根据需要进行更改。3. 添加规则:使用`firewall-cmd –zone=[zone] –add-[service/port]=
`命令添加规则。
其中`[zone]`为防火墙区域,`[service/port]`为要添加的服务或端口。4. 重新加载防火墙:使用`firewall-cmd –reload`命令重新加载防火墙配置文件。
5. 检查规则:使用`firewall-cmd –zone=[zone] –list-all`命令检查所添加的规则是否生效。
6. 停止防火墙:使用`systemctl stop firewalld`命令停止防火墙。
7. 关闭防火墙:使用`systemctl disable firewalld`命令关闭防火墙,防止开机自动启动。
总结:
本文介绍了Linux 7系统中常用的防火墙命令及其操作流程。防火墙的使用对于保护计算机网络安全至关重要,希望本文对您有所帮助。
2年前